Belgium manager Roberto Martinez says he is wary of a Japan team with “incredible energy” ahead of Monday’s World Cup last-16 clash.

The free-scoring Belgians go in as firm favourites, taking with them a 100 per cent record from the group phase and netting nine goals in beating Panama, Tunisia and England.

With players like Eden Hazard and Romelu Lukaku at his disposal, Martinez’s team have more than enough quality to match their achievement at the last World Cup and secure a place in the quarter-finals, where Brazil could await.
